John Chanlor's story of living his dream job since age 7, as a deep sea diver, a la early John Wayne movies. Among others he worked with specialty companies hired by British Petroleum, Chevron. etc., in our Gulf as well as off the coast of Scotland and Alaska -- sometime for days at a time in a chamber pressure-ized at the surface for 300 feet or more depth from which he would take 8 hour shifts below. He owes a good bit of his early opportunity to start his own construction and diving business to government support through the 8A program because of his historical family membership in the Choctaw Indian Tribe.
